
Java Developer, German
regiocom SE
full-time
Posted on:
Location Type: Hybrid
Location: Sofia • Bulgaria
Visit company websiteExplore more
About the role
- Maintain, enhance, and refactor existing backend systems
- Develop and support applications using Java 21/25 LTS
- Work within an agile development environment alongside cross-functional teams
- Troubleshoot issues, ensure long-term stability, and improve code quality
- Collaborate closely with product owners and stakeholders
- Contribute to technical decisions, documentation, and continuous improvement
Requirements
- Bachelor’s degree in Computer Science, Engineering, or a related field (or equivalent experience)
- Strong experience in Java (preferably Java 21/25 LTS)
- Experience working with or maintaining backend architectures
- Solid understanding of software design, clean code principles, and testing practices
- Very good German language skills (B2 or higher) and good English skills
- Independent, solution-oriented, and structured working style
- Ability to collaborate in distributed and multicultural teams
- Additional skills that will give you a strong advantage: experience with NetBeans RCP, familiarity with Bitbucket, working experience with Linux
Benefits
- Hybrid working – work from home or from our offices
- Additional health insurance, including dental care
- Up to 26 days of paid annual leave
- Food vouchers
- Team-building activities and special Regiocom events
- A pleasant, highly collegial, and technologically modern working environment
- Ongoing personal and professional development through training
- Competitive compensation based on your skills, plus a package of social benefits
- Opportunity to work on long-term, exciting projects
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
Java 21Java 25backend systemssoftware designclean code principlestesting practices
Soft Skills
collaborationsolution-orientedstructured working styleindependent
Certifications
Bachelor’s degree in Computer ScienceBachelor’s degree in Engineering